Websites hosted on 108.187.136.94 IP Address

Geo Location Information for 108.187.136.94 IP Address. The IP Address 108.187.136.94 is located at 34.197 latitude and -118.8199 longitude in United States. Friendly Location for the IP Address is California, Thousand Oaks, United States, 91362


五福彩票_官网app下载
- rkmth89.top

大慶路燈廠_大慶太陽能路燈_大慶庭院燈_大慶燈具制造_大慶燈具公司_大慶LED_大慶節能產品_大慶環保燈_大慶奧特龍燈具制造有限公司

rkmth89.top alexa Not Applicable   rkmth89.top worth $ 8.95

北京pk10手机版_官网app下载
- wkbhh73.top

????????????【北京pk10手机版高返点平台】,【北京pk10手机版官网登录】,【北京pk10手机版下载送彩金】,【北京pk10手机版注册中心】,【北京pk10手机版安全购彩】,【北京pk10手机版360下载】,【北京pk10手机版腾讯推荐】,【北京pk10手机版腾讯直营】,【北京pk10手机版官网VIP入口】,【北京pk10手机版app安装...

wkbhh73.top alexa Not Applicable   wkbhh73.top worth $ 8.95

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.